Places to eat at the Aquarium

Waves Café

Our Waves Café, overlooking the beautiful Barbican harbour, is open and ready to welcome you during your visit. There is a wide variety of hot food, sandwiches, teas, coffees, hot chocolates, cakes, biscuits & pastries, bottled drinks and ice cream available to purchase.

The National Marine Aquarium (NMA) is the UK’s largest aquarium, located in Britain’s Ocean City, Plymouth. It is run by the Ocean Conservation Trust, a charity dedicated to connecting people with the Ocean.
